As a Developer in Identity and Access Management, you will play a pivotal role in developing and supporting application solutions, resolving production issues, and performing testing activities. Collaborating closely with client personnel and other teams, you will contribute to identifying functional requirements and designing tailored solutions.
- Develop and support application solutions while assisting in production issue resolution.
- Write code and perform technical or configuration-related tasks.
- Conduct comprehensive testing activities.
- Collaborate with client personnel and teams to identify functional requirements.
- Participate in design activities, from requirements analysis to systems, application, and/or process design specification and implementation.
- Build expertise across multiple platforms, processes, or architectures.
- Proficiency in using Node.js to build server-side applications, APIs, and microservices.
- Ability to design, develop, and maintain both front-end and back-end systems.
- Hands-on experience with modern front-end frameworks like React, Angular, or Vue.js.
- Familiarity with RESTful services, GraphQL APIs, and ensuring seamless integration between the client-side and server-side components.
- Understanding of No-SQL databases such as MongoDB, DynamoDB, or Couchbase.
- Proficiency in working with relational databases such as MySQL, PostgreSQL, or MS SQL Server.
- Familiarity with Agile principles, frameworks (Scrum, Kanban), and iterative development practices.
- Expertise in writing unit tests, integration tests, and end-to-end tests using tools like Jest, Mocha, or Jasmine.
NA